A commercial enzyme lin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A) for detection of adenoviruses in stool samples was compared with the use of electron microscopy and isolation in Graham 293 cells. Although specific, the ELISA was less sensitive than both electron microscopy and isolation. The ELISA had an overall sensitivity of 78% and a specificity of 100%. Autophagy is a catabolic process that produces energy through lysosomal degradation of intracellular organelles. Autophagy functions as a cytoprotective factor under physiological conditions such as nutrient deprivation, hypoxia, and interruption of growth factors.
